This is the only way to have steaks...I've made this some time and have some steak tips;Make sure strip steaks are 1 inch to 1 1/4 inch thick or they will overcook. Grill on high (preheat) grill 9-11 minutes total turning once! I marinade 1 hour and remove outer edge fat. DEEElicious!!
